Yet another case for reforming the medical device industry

The New York Times just published a heartbreaking exposé about medical tubing and deaths that can result from nurses and doctors inserting the incorrect tubes into patients’ veins and bodies – ie inserting a feeding tube into a vein. http://www.nytimes.com/2010/08/21/health/policy/21tubes.html?_r=1&ref=health

Patients, hospitals, and many in the industry advocate making different kinds of tubing for different functions that are incompatible with one another so that this kind of mistake could not be made.  However, this initiative has run into major regulatory hurdles as the FDA has been slow to insist that this kind of tubing be put into use and industry advocates have challenged the necessity. 

The article is disheartening for a number of reasons.  The FDA is largely considered the most successful US regulatory agency (http://www.newyorker.com/talk/financial/2010/06/14/100614ta_talk_surowiecki ), yet even it has major systematic process errors like the ones described in the article that allow it to approve devices closely resembling those that have been recalled.  It also, like many government agencies, is not a fast-moving body.  The tube issue is clearly one it clearly must correct, yet the response has been incredibly slow.  The article also brings to light the flaws of a system that gives too much voice to industry concerns.  This is a case in which a simple adjustment of design would prevent a simple mistake from killing a patient; clearly, it’s a time when the public interest needs to outweigh the demands of a business.  However, industry lobbying has slowed the process and allowed for more deaths to occur. 
However, in some ways  be seen as inspiring.  The issues with tubing can be easily solved once hurdles are cleared.  There are many cases in medicine where simple changes can begin to eliminate unnecessary loss of life.  Coordinating such changes will be a massive challenge, but such changes are possible.  Standardizing medical devices so that doctors will not waste time figuring out how to use a new machine, setting up operating trays in the same way, implementing electronic record-keeping, and many other examples will help prevent mistakes from being made when they are eventually implemented.  There are so many clear paths forward in improving medical care and preventing medical errors; the challenge will be in sticking with these plans and following through on implementation. Key to this will be reforming the medical device industry -- forcing companies to standardize designs and adhere to safety-maximizing standards will be a huge, but not insurmountable challenge.
